Swaps and substitutions
For a nut-free version, replace the walnuts with toasted pumpkin or sunflower seeds. To keep it vegan, swap the honey for maple syrup or agave; for lower sugar, use less sweetener and add a little extra vinegar.
What to serve with it
Serve this salad as a light main with crusty bread or warm soup for a fuller lunch. It also pairs well with grilled chicken, roasted salmon, or a simple bean dish if you want extra protein.
